Pergunta

Estou tentando abrir um recurso passando o resultado de context.getResources (). GetString (r.Drawable.myimage) para outra classe que não é uma atividade. context.getResources (). getString (r.Drawable.myimage) Retorna res/drawable mdpi/myimage.png No entanto, quando tento abrir esse arquivo, ele lança uma FILENOTFoundException.

Qual é a maneira correta de abrir um recurso fora de uma atividade?

Foi útil?

Solução

Você pode postar o código onde tenta abrir o arquivo.

res/drawable mdpi/myimage.png é um caminho relativo, não um absoluto. Eu acho que você não está abrindo o caminho correto usando o caminho relativo e não absoluto.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top